Two small patches for 2.6.25 which enable some new labeled networking features and fixes. One patch introduces a new outbound packet LSM hook and one adds the skb 'iif' field to the list of fields copied during a clone operation.
Both of these patches are part of a much larger patchset that has been under review on the SELinux and LSM mailing lists for the past few months (some bits have been under review since this past spring). I'll save everyone the spam and not post the entire patchset here, but if you want to take a look you can find the latest bits here: * git://git.infradead.org/users/pcmoore/lblnet-2.6_testing I'm posting these patches here for review and hopefully an 'Acked-by', not inclusion into net-2.6.25. If these patches are acceptable then they will pushed upstream with the rest of the changes when 2.6.25 is ready.
